Hilary Knight made her stance clear on President Donald Trump's quip about the United States women's ice hockey team that won Olympic gold last week.

While on the phone with the men's team after they had won gold, Trump said he would "have" to invite the women’s team, which also beat Canada to win the Olympics, to Tuesday’s State of the Union. Otherwise, he "probably would be impeached."

Knight, the women's captain and all-time leading goal scorer and points leader, said on Wednesday's edition of ESPN's "SportsCenter" that Trump's "distasteful joke" has "overshadow[ed]" the women's success.

"I thought it was sort of a distasteful joke, and, unfortunately, that is overshadowing a lot of the success, the success of just women at the Olympics carrying for Team USA and having amazing gold medal feats," Knight said.

"We're just focusing on celebrating the women in our room, the extraordinary efforts, and continue to celebrate three gold medals in program history as well as the double gold for both men's and women's at the same time. And really not detract from that with a distasteful joke."
